Overview

Hotel Tea Room in Davenport has accumulated 53 violations across 30 inspections since 2017, averaging 1.8 per visit. The facility has not been shut down and faces no fines. Hand washing and chemical storage are the most frequently cited issues, with recent inspections showing consistent low-level non-compliance across 2024 and 2025.

Summary generated from Florida DBPR public inspection records.

Hotel Tea Room in Davenport: Frequently Asked Questions

When was Hotel Tea Room in Davenport last inspected?
Hotel Tea Room in Davenport was last inspected by Florida DBPR on April 7, 2026. The result was: Administrative complaint recommended.
What are the most common violations at Hotel Tea Room in Davenport?
The most frequently cited violations at Hotel Tea Room in Davenport are: Proper hand/arm washing, Chemical properly stored, Employee health reporting.
How many health inspections has Hotel Tea Room in Davenport had?
Hotel Tea Room in Davenport has had 31 inspections on record with Florida DBPR, averaging 1.7 violations per inspection, below the statewide average of 5.2.
What did the most recent inspection of Hotel Tea Room in Davenport find?
Hotel Tea Room in Davenport was most recently inspected on April 7, 2026 with 1 violation(s), including 1 high-priority violation(s). Disposition: Administrative complaint recommended.
Has Hotel Tea Room in Davenport ever been shut down?
No, Hotel Tea Room in Davenport has no emergency closures on record with Florida DBPR.
